Airborne multi-sensor platform with potential for hydrological applications: demonstration of fluorescence measurements of turbidity

摘要

The multi-sensor system installed on a Do228 aircraft is used in Germany for operational surveillance for maritime oil pollution. It includes radar, a laser fluorescence sensor and other near-range sensors with ultra-violet, thermal infrared and microwave channels. This system is dedicated and specialized for the detection and characterization of maritime oil spills. Nevertheless, it has potential for hydrological applications, e.g. the monitoring of turbidity or suspended particulate matter (SPM). Laser fluorescence measurements along the tidal River Elbe correspond well to the expected characteristics of turbidity distribution. Even the correlation with point measurements of SPM concentration shows promising results.
